Signs Your Garbage Disposal Needs Professional Service
Unusual noises often indicate mechanical problems requiring professional attention. Grinding sounds suggest foreign objects in the grinding chamber, while rattling noises may indicate loose mounting hardware or damaged impellers.
Frequent reset button tripping signals electrical or mechanical issues beyond simple overload conditions. This behavior often indicates failing motor windings or bearing wear that will worsen without professional intervention.
Persistent odors despite cleaning efforts suggest food waste accumulation in hard-to-reach areas or bacterial growth in the disposal chamber. Professional cleaning removes these deposits and sanitizes the unit to eliminate odors at their source.
Slow draining even when the disposal runs indicates partial clogs in the drain line or P-trap. These blockages can cause standing water in the sink and may require specialized drain cleaning equipment to resolve completely.
Visible leaks from the disposal housing or mounting flange require immediate attention to prevent water damage to cabinets and surrounding structures. Small leaks often indicate seal failure that will worsen without repair.

Choosing Between Repair and Replacement
Age considerations play a crucial role in repair versus replacement decisions. Disposals over seven years old often cost more to repair than replace, especially when multiple components show signs of wear or failure.
Repair costs approaching 50% of replacement cost typically indicate that replacement offers better long-term value. This calculation includes both parts and labor for the repair versus the complete replacement unit and installation.
Energy efficiency improvements in newer models can offset replacement costs through reduced electricity consumption. Modern disposals use advanced motor technology that operates more quietly and efficiently than older units.
Warranty coverage provides additional value for replacement units, often including 5-10 year protection against defects and premature failure. This coverage eliminates future repair costs during the warranty period.

Preventing Future Disposal Problems
Proper use habits extend disposal life significantly. Avoid putting fibrous vegetables, coffee grounds, eggshells, and grease down the disposal, as these materials cause the most common clogs and jams in Corona kitchens.
Regular cleaning prevents odor buildup and maintains grinding efficiency. Monthly cleaning with ice cubes and citrus peels helps remove food residue from grinding chamber surfaces and eliminates unpleasant odors.
Water quality affects disposal longevity. Corona’s hard water causes mineral scale buildup on motor components and seals, reducing efficiency and lifespan. Installing a water softener or using descaling treatments can mitigate these effects.
Load management prevents motor strain and premature failure. Feed food waste gradually rather than all at once, and always run cold water during operation to help flush waste through the drain system.

Can I fix a humming disposal myself?
Many humming disposals can be reset using the hex key wrench to manually turn the flywheel and clear jams. However, if the reset button doesn’t restore function or you hear electrical buzzing, professional service is recommended to prevent damage.
What causes disposal leaks in Corona homes?
Leaks typically result from worn seals, cracked housings, or loose mounting hardware. Corona’s hard water accelerates seal deterioration, while temperature fluctuations cause expansion and contraction that can create gaps in connections over time.
